Webブラウザをハードリフレッシュする方法(キャッシュをバイパスするため)

Webサイトが期待どおりに動作しない場合や、古い情報が表示されない場合があります。これを修正するには、単純なキーボードショートカットを使用して、ブラウザにページのローカルコピー(キャッシュ)を完全に再読み込みさせるのは簡単です。これがその方法です。

ブラウザキャッシュとは何ですか?

ブラウジングを高速化するために、Webブラウザーは、Webサイトデータのコピーをキャッシュと呼ばれるファイルのセットとしてコンピューターに保存します。Webサイトをロードすると、キャッシュから取得したサイトの要素(画像など)のローカルコピーが表示されることがよくあります。

通常、ブラウザがWebサイトをロードして変更を検出すると、リモートWebサーバーからサイトの新しいバージョンをフェッチし、キャッシュを置き換えます。ただし、プロセスは完全ではなく、ブラウザのキャッシュにあるWebサイトデータのローカルコピーがサーバー上の最新バージョンと一致しない場合があります。その結果、Webページが正しく表示されなかったり、正しく機能しなかったりする場合があります。

これを修正するには、Webブラウザーにキャッシュに既にあるものを破棄し、サイトの最新バージョンをダウンロードするように強制する必要があります。多くの人がこれを「ハードリフレッシュ」と呼んでいます。

ブラウザでハードリフレッシュを実行する方法

PCおよびMacのほとんどのブラウザーでは、単純なアクションを実行してハードリフレッシュを強制できます。キーボードのShiftキーを押しながら、ブラウザのツールバーのリロードアイコンをクリックします。

同等のハードリフレッシュを実行するためのキーボードショートカットもあります。同じアクションを実行する方法は複数あるため、以下にリストします。

  • Chrome、Firefox、またはEdge for Windows: Ctrl + F5を押します(それが機能しない場合は、Shift + F5またはCtrl + Shift + Rを試してください)。
  • ChromeまたはFirefoxfor Mac: Shift + Command + Rを押します。
  • Safari for Mac:ハードリフレッシュを強制するための簡単なキーボードショートカットはありません。代わりに、Command + Option + Eを押してキャッシュを空にし、Shiftキーを押しながらツールバーの[再読み込み]をクリックします。
  • iPhoneおよびiPad用Safari: キャッシュを強制的に更新するショートカットはありません。ブラウザのキャッシュを消去するには、設定を詳しく調べる必要があります。

ハードリフレッシュを実行すると、Webページが空白になり、再読み込みプロセスに通常よりも時間がかかります。これは、ブラウザがサイト上のすべてのデータと画像を再ダウンロードしているためです。

強制的に更新しても問題が解決しない場合は、ハード更新を再試行できます。それでも問題が解決しない場合は、ウェブサイト自体に問題があるか、ブラウザの更新が必要な可能性があります。幸運を!